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Seer Green & Jordans to Sherburn-in-Elmet start from as little as £44.60

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Seer Green & Jordans to Sherburn-in-Elmet start from £76.10 one way, or £169.20 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Seer Green & Jordans to Sherburn-in-Elmet are available for £149.50 one way, or £298.90 return

Facilities and Amenities

When it comes to facilities, Seer Green & Jordans offers a range of essentials that cover basic commuter needs. The ticket office is available on weekdays from 06:10 to 10:40, ensuring you can purchase or collect your tickets comfortably. Ticket machines are present and designed to be accessible to all, making your entry and exit swift and uncomplicated. The station features a step-free access option, though it's limited mainly to platform 2 for London-bound trains. Customer assistance is readily available through help points and staff presence during ticket office hours to assist travelers with queries and enhancements to their experience.

Accessibility is a concern that's addressed with thought. There are some limitations, such as the lack of accessible toilets, but provisions like induction loops, accessible ticket machines, and ramps are present. Those needing assistance can book it in advance for peace of mind using the Passenger Assist initiative—more details can be found here.

Onward Travel Options

While the station doesn't cater to rail replacement buses due to tricky road access, travelers are encouraged to use the help point at the station to arrange alternative transportation like taxis to nearby Chiltern Railways stations. Station Facilities and Accessibility

Sherburn-in-Elmet train station provides basic facilities essential for travelers. Although the station lacks a ticket office, ticket machines are available for purchase and collection, making it convenient for those who prefer buying tickets on the go. For those with specific requirements, accessible ticket machines are located on Platform 1, offering an induction loop as well. However, travelers with mobility challenges may face difficulties due to limited step-free access. The Barrow crossing, with its gap, poses a particular challenge for wheelchair users.

Interestingly, despite its cozy setting, the station does not offer staff help or waiting rooms. Nevertheless, it does provide essential customer help points. For other needs, such as refreshments, shops, or toilet facilities, visitors would need to explore nearby alternatives. Additionally, if you're planning to drive here, plentiful free parking ensures hassle-free arrival and departure, though it might be wise to plan ahead as there are no CCTV facilities.

Onward Travel Options

While Sherburn-in-Elmet might seem remote, its connectivity ensures you won't be stuck. On the A162 near the station approach, bus stops cater to those needing an alternative to train journeys, particularly during rail replacements. Although direct bicycle hire isn't available, taxi services are a viable choice. You can plan your next move and view options through Cab4You, ensuring you stay mobile even if you choose not to drive.
